Jammu: The ceasefire has been violated by the Pakistan Army in the Baktur sector of Bandipora district. There is heavy mortar shelling from the border. The Indian Army is giving a befitting reply to this action of Pakistan. On Monday, 3 February 2020, Poonch Pakistan started firing on the Line of Control (LoC) in Tangdhar sector of North Kashmir's Kupwara district for the second consecutive day. A civilian was killed in this where the two Jats of the Army and 17 Bihar Regiment gave a strong answer to Pakistan. The shelling from Pakistan continued till late evening.

According to the information received, Pakistan started firing in the Gurez sector of Bandipora at around 6:30 pm. Meanwhile, the army demolished the terrorist hideout in Poonch, thwarting the terror plot. A large quantity of ammunition has been recovered from the terrorist hideout. In the Tangdhar sector, shells were targeted at the residential areas along with the forward posts from Pakistan. A civilian was seriously injured in this. He died on the spot. The deceased has been identified as Mohammad Salim (50). The SSP has confirmed the death of the citizen. There is panic among villagers due to shelling.

In the reports that the administration has made preparations to take the villagers to a safe place. The administration says that bulletproof vehicles have been kept ready. As well as safe places for the villagers have also been marked. If needed, they will be shifted.
